Understanding Supply Chain Disruptions

In today's interconnected world, supply chain disruptions can have far-reaching consequences for B2B companies. Understanding the causes and consequences of these disruptions is essential for effective management.

Identifying Root Causes

Supply chain disruptions can arise from various factors, including natural disasters, geopolitical tensions, and shifts in consumer demand. Identifying these root causes enables companies to adapt their strategies accordingly.

Implementing Risk Management Practices

Implementing risk management practices is crucial for mitigating potential disruptions. Developing contingency plans and maintaining flexibility within the supply chain can help businesses respond effectively to unforeseen challenges.

Leveraging Technology for Resilience

Utilizing technology, such as blockchain and real-time tracking systems, can enhance supply chain transparency and resilience. These tools enable businesses to monitor their supply chains more effectively and respond to issues as they arise.
